Simultaneous Welding

In this process, the entire weld seam is heated simultaneously by one or more lasers.

Most of these are high-power diode lasers because of their compact design. Linear weld seams can be produced with ease. Almost any beam shape can be created by means of beam shaping elements.

Characteristics and application:

  • Short process time
  • No relative movement
  • Gap bridging possible
  • Suitable for mass production
